2010.05.31 14:40, lietuvys rašė: > Su Mega168 Bandžiau tavo metodą, tačiau nesėkmingai. Susikompiliavau > kodą > http://cs.wikibooks.org/wiki/Programujeme_jedno%C4%8Dipy/VnParProg_c_code > > su optimizacija o1, atkomentavau chip_erase. palik vien tik chip_erase pradžioje. Toliau yra nustatomi fuse'ų reikšmės, kurios skiriasi tarp mega8 ir tiny2313. Idealiame pasaulyje reikia nuskaityti čipo signatūrą ir pagal ją nustatyti reikšmes. > Bandžiau ir su reversuotu RESET signalu, kadangi naudoju vieną NFET'ą > ir 150 omų rezistorių. Vis tiek nieko. invertuoti signalo nereikia. Aukštas RESET lygis atidaro FET'ą (tikiuosi 540'as yra 'depletion mode'?) > FET'us naudojau TO-220 korpuse IRF540N, IRLZ34N, neturėjau mažesnių, > bet ar dėl to gali būti bėda? jokio skirtumo. TO-220 geresnis šilumos atidavimas, kas gelbėja jei didelė atviro kanalo varža. Aš iš skūpumo sudėjau įtampos stabilizatorius SO-92 korpuse. karšti zarazos ;) > Su testeriu rodo kaip kinta įtampa ant reset kojos 0, 12 (kokias 8s), > 0 V. Gal neteisingai FET'ą pajungiau? Prisegu schemą. S-D nesupainiojai (nors nedidelis skirtumas)? > Gal gali duoti savo e-mail'ą? negelbės. Pirma, šią savaitę užsikrovės darbu, antra - komplikuotas priėjimas prie darbo vietos. -- ejs